At the beginning it was even called &#8220;\u0411\u0422\u041a&#8221; &#8211; &#8220;\u0411\u0438\u043e\u0422\u0430\u0440 \u041a\u0440\u0430\u0441\u043d\u043e\u0433\u043e\u0440\u0441\u043a\u0438\u0439&#8221; (<strong>BioTar<\/strong> Krasnogorski).\u00a0 At the end of Wold War II the Russians took the Zeiss&#8217; designs and materials back to Russia and copied them. The Soviet Union manufactured millions of this lens in different variants and it shipped as standard lens on many Soviet (Zenit) cameras.\u00a0 KMZ (the same factory that made the Zenit cameras) started manufacturing this lens from 1945. The Helios 44 lenses have built a cult around themselves in modern days and have been very popular for portrait photography and videography, it is the number one vintage lens used for making videos on modern cameras. It is very popular for its image character, its clickless aperture, balanced center sharpness and not least its swirly bokeh. the early silver metal body; an original very early version with a bayonet mount and 40.5mm filter size and this one, which has an M39 screw mount with 49mm filter size. This second version exists in three variants; the first variant had 13 aperture blades in the range of f\/2-f\/22, second version (the one in this review) has also 13 aperture blades\u00a0 but with the range of f\/2-f\/16 and the last variant has only 8 aperture blades f\/2-f\/16.<\/p>\n<p>Later versions are all black and have the namings 44-2 (the most spread version), 44-3, 44M, 44M-4, 44M-5, 44M-6 and the final 44M-7. The 44-2 version itself has been produced in different variants and at different factories (KMZ, BeLOMO and Valdai)\u00a0 in the Soviet Union. The focus ring turns a massive 300 degrees and it runs extremely smooth being very well damped, it\u2019s a pleasure to use. <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Helios has an aperture preset mechanism at the front with two rings; o<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">ne with not equidistant aperture markings on it, which clicks rather stiffly between each f-stop to set &#8220;the smallest aperture you want to work with&#8221; (it is the ring at the top in the picture above). <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The lower aperture ring is clickless that turns extremely smooth and can set the aperture from wide open to the value you have set on the top ring. (Example: say you set the top ring to f\/5.6, with the lower ring you set\/change the aperture without any clicks from f\/2 down to as far as f\/5.6 but not beyond it). This is a nice feature for video makers as it means they can precisely control the light levels as they shoot and change the aperture without any shaking during the filming and without &#8220;jumps&#8221; in the scene light level when going from one aperture setting to another.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The early Helioses (like the one in this review) have 13 aperture blades (that\u2019s 5 more than the later 44-2) and also have an M39 mount rather than M42. The center area becomes just almost OK at f\/4. At f\/5.6 it is good and very good at f\/8 and f\/11. Mid-frame sharpness becomes good at f\/8 and smaller. At f\/16 the image becomes a little softer everywhere due to diffraction. It is not normal that the sharpness is so bad at f\/2 and f\/2.8, not even for a vintage lens from the Soviet Union. By controlling the whole image you can see that the sharpness is much better at wider f\/stops at closer distances (about 20-30m) when the focusing ring is set at infinity.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_40221\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-40221\" style=\"width: 800px\" class=\"wp-caption alignnone\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-40221 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/Compare.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"800\" height=\"400\" srcset=\"https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/Compare.jpg 800w, https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/Compare-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/Compare-768x384.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-40221\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Nikon Z6 | Helios 44 | f\/2.8 | focus at infinity (Left: 50-60m away, Right: About 20-30m away)<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>It shows that the lens cannot focus at infinity. The lens block does simply not recess enough to be able to set the focus at very long distances. It seems that the focus is at about 25m to 30m. At f\/5.6 or smaller the problem is not noticeable anymore as the depth of field has increased so much that everything is within the depth of field from 13m to almost infinity (or around 500m) if the focus is set to 25m. This is a common problem with Helios 44 lenses on many modern cameras. (the reason is that M39 camera flange distance is 45.2 mm, while an M42 camera flange distance is 45.46mm, when using an M42 lens adapter on modern cameras, there is a difference of 0.26mm, the lens is 0.26mm too far from the sensor when it is set to infinity and therefore not in correct focus position). It is possible to modify the lens by a (relatively simple) surgical procedure to remedy the issue. style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The beauty of bokeh is in the eyes of the beholder and it seems that it looks quite pretty and attractive in quite a number of people&#8217;s eyes. It is actually one of the strengths of this lens. Both its swirly character and soft background blur at closer distances especially for portraits. The extra blades do make a difference to the smoothness of the bokeh closed down. When it comes to this lens specific bokeh character, swirly bokeh, it is good to mention that in spite of common belief, t<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">he swirls don\u2019t magically appear on all images. You have to work hard to find the right compositions, background and light to get those swirls but when you do, the results are wonderful.<\/span><\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_40538\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-40538\" style=\"width: 800px\" class=\"wp-caption alignnone\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-40538 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/DSC_1949_PR.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"800\" height=\"532\" srcset=\"https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/DSC_1949_PR.jpg 800w, https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/DSC_1949_PR-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/phillipreeve.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/05\/DSC_1949_PR-768x511.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px\" \/><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-40538\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Nikon Z6 | Helios 44 58mm f\/2 | f\/2<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Conclusion<\/span><\/h2>\n<table>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"color: green;\"><b>I LIKE<\/b><\/td>\n<td style=\"color: grey;\"><b>INDIFFERENT \/ AVERAGE<\/b><\/td>\n<td style=\"color: red;\"><b>I DON&#8217;T LIKE<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Swirly bokeh<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Center sharpness<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Bokeh (at close)\u00a0<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">portrait<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">300\u00b0 focus throw\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/td>\n<td>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sharpness inner center periphery<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Vintage look<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Distortion<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Vignetting<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/td>\n<td>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flare resistance<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sharpness off center<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">bokeh at mid and long distance<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sharpness at infinity<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The main reasons about Helios of course is the swirly bokeh (and its vintage look and feel).
